Executive summary

  • Adjusted revenues for Q3 2024 were $281 million, with year-to-date adjusted revenues reaching $763 million, up 18% year-over-year, driven by growth across all major product areas and strong M&A activity.

  • Net income for the nine months was $51.6 million, reversing a net loss of $21.1 million in the prior year period.

  • The firm operates a capital-light, high free cash flow model with no debt, serving clients in over 45 countries and emphasizing organic growth and strategic hiring.

  • Gradual improvement in the M&A market observed, with pipelines and announced transactions at all-time highs, though deal completion times remain extended.

  • Strong demand continues for structured capital solutions and capital structure advisory, with a prolonged restructuring cycle anticipated due to upcoming non-investment grade debt maturities.

Financial highlights

  • Q3 2024 adjusted revenues were $281 million; first nine months: $763 million, up 18% year-over-year.

  • Q3 2024 net income was $19.2 million, compared to a net loss of $11.4 million in Q3 2023.

  • Adjusted Q3 2024 operating income margin was 8.1%, with compensation ratio at 75% and non-compensation ratio at 16.9%.

  • Cash and liquid investments totaled $297.7 million at quarter-end, with no debt.

  • Regular quarterly dividend of $0.60 per share declared.

Outlook and guidance

  • Expectation for continued gradual improvement in business activity, with potential for acceleration depending on market and macroeconomic factors.

  • A prolonged restructuring cycle is anticipated due to significant non-investment grade debt maturities.

  • Commitment to organic growth, high pre-tax margins through cycles, and continued investment in talent and sector coverage.

  • Compensation ratio may improve if market conditions strengthen in Q4; leverage model remains valid barring significant hiring.

  • 2025 anticipated to be a good to very good year, contingent on capital raising conditions in the private equity market.
